Output 7085697d42870b2551f7e2fd5dedf61d33200423ec2b82410457106e4969b05d:23

value
1558784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f862ad9cb0bd8df9e57cac4a6869d26cd84900 OP_EQUAL
address
3AAbeKKEH3hPJ8WCisNeJH1kNu6ghpEQhW
transaction
7085697d42870b2551f7e2fd5dedf61d33200423ec2b82410457106e4969b05d
spent
true